rcu: Change _wait_rcu_gp() to work around GCC bug 67055

Code like this in inline functions confuses some recent versions of gcc:

const int n = const-expr;
whatever_t array[n];

For more details, see:

https://gcc.gnu.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=67055#c13

This compiler bug results in the following failure after 114b7fd4b (rcu:
Create rcu_sync infrastructure):

In file included from include/linux/rcupdate.h:429:0,
  from include/linux/rcu_sync.h:5,
  from kernel/rcu/sync.c:1:
include/linux/rcutiny.h: In function 'rcu_barrier_sched':
include/linux/rcutiny.h:55:20: internal compiler error: Segmentation fault
  static inline void rcu_barrier_sched(void)

This commit therefore eliminates the constant local variable in favor of
direct use of the expression.
